Neo Mystery Bonus is a sports game that tosses together a handful of short, strange mini-games into one odd package. Developed by DYNA and released in 1999 for the Neo Geo Pocket Color, it swaps structured competition for chaotic, bite-sized challenges. Players bounce between activities like racing, batting, and even dodging falling objects, each with its own goofy rules. Controls are simple but repetitive, and the randomized elements keep things unpredictable. The game’s appeal lies in its randomness, offering moments of absurd fun rather than polished gameplay. The title stands out as a forgotten relic of the late 90s handheld scene. While not widely remembered, it’s a niche oddity that shows SNK’s willingness to experiment. The Neo Geo Pocket Color’s library is full of curiosities, and this fits right in. With minimal stakes and brief sessions, it’s best approached as a novelty. No major ratings or reviews exist, but collectors occasionally highlight it as a quirky footnote in the system’s history. Short, strange, and strangely charming.
